The DS Lite’s Dual Cartridge Slots: A Key Feature

The Nintendo DS Lite has two slots for game cartridges, unlike its predecessor, the original DS. This is a crucial point for our discussion about GBA compatibility. The top slot is specifically for Nintendo DS games, those small, sleek cartridges we all know. Now, let’s get to the star of the show – the bottom slot. This is where the magic happens; it’s designed to accept Game Boy Advance cartridges. It’s wider and shorter than the top slot, making it impossible to insert a DS game, but it’s just the right size for your GBA collection. This dual-slot design is the very reason you can play GBA games on your DS Lite. Think of it as having two separate game consoles built into one cool device.

How to Insert GBA Games Correctly

Inserting your GBA game correctly is easy but important. If you try to force the game in, you could damage the cartridge or the system. Here is how you do it:

  • Locate the bottom slot: It’s wider than the top slot.
  • Align the cartridge: The label on the GBA game should face toward the front of the DS Lite.
  • Gently insert the game: Slide the cartridge smoothly into the slot until you feel a gentle click. Don’t force it; it should fit easily.

If the game does not fit or doesn’t work, you need to remove it and check for any dirt in the contacts of both the game card and DS card slot. Also, verify the game is an authentic Game Boy Advance cartridge.

Potential Issues and Troubleshooting

While the DS Lite’s GBA compatibility is generally solid, you might run into a few hiccups. It’s good to know what these could be, and what you can do to resolve them. Here are a few issues you might experience and some ways to resolve them. Most of the time, it is just something simple.

Cartridge Not Reading

Sometimes, your DS Lite might not recognize your GBA game. This could be due to dirty contacts on either the cartridge or the DS Lite’s cartridge slot. You can try the following:

  • Clean the Cartridge Contacts: Use a cotton swab dipped in a bit of isopropyl alcohol to clean the metal contacts on the GBA cartridge. Let them dry completely before re-inserting.
  • Clean the DS Lite Slot: You can also use a clean cotton swab, or canned air to clear any dirt or debris from the GBA cartridge slot on the DS Lite.
  • Try another GBA game: If another GBA game is recognized, you can rule out a problem with your DS Lite. If the second game is still not recognized, then we will know the problem is with the DS Lite card slot.

With a bit of care and cleaning you should be able to get your GBA games up and running. If nothing above works, you may want to take your DS Lite to a qualified electronics repair shop.

Game Freezing or Crashing

Occasionally, a GBA game might freeze or crash during play. This could be due to several factors, such as a faulty cartridge or a problem with the DS Lite. Here are a few steps you can try:

  • Try a different DS Lite: If you have access to another DS Lite, see if the problem persists. This can help you determine if the issue is with the game or the console.
  • Check the Cartridge: Examine the game for any visible damage, such as cracks or broken connectors. If you see any damage, the cartridge may be beyond repair, but if you only notice a bit of dirt, you can clean it like we discussed in the section above.
  • Make sure you have an official cart: There are some unofficial or bootleg GBA games out there. These may not work properly on the DS Lite. You should make sure that your cartridge is official by looking at the cartridge closely.

GBA Games on Different DS Models

While we are discussing GBA games on the DS Lite, it’s worth briefly touching on the other models of the Nintendo DS. The original Nintendo DS also includes a GBA cartridge slot. However, not all Nintendo DS family models have this GBA support. The Nintendo DSi, DSi XL, 3DS, 3DS XL, 2DS, and 2DS XL systems do not have a GBA cartridge slot, and therefore can not support GBA games. The DS Lite and the original DS are the only models that are able to play GBA game cartridges.
